prepared by the contractor if required by the Authority and must then be approved before
execution. Signs shall be self‑contained multi‑utility emergency exit units (wall‑mounted type)
with moulded PC white body, IP20 rating or higher, Li‑ion rechargeable battery, flame‑retardant
housing and minimum 90‑minute emergency backup as per NBC 4.3.4.7.1.f, of approved make or
equivalent. Artwork including legend, arrow and pictogram shall be printed on ARS 10000 or
equivalent photoluminescent rigid sheet, complying with PSPA Class A / DIN 67510 luminance
criteria and certified by an approved Government of India laboratory, DRDO and ARAI or
equivalent, and shall incorporate Braille text formed by raster‑Braille process to specified dome
shape and dimensions. Units shall include all internal drivers, chargers, LEDs and control
electronics, with power points and FRLS wiring from designated source, earthing and protection.
Signs shall be mounted on wall surfaces using 3M VHB tape or equivalent and/or concealed
fixings at 1500 mm from FFL, with all substrate preparation, drilling, any necessary breaking or
cutting of RCC, steel, structural steel or masonry and complete making good of disturbed finishes
included, as well as cleaning, protection and any dismantling/re‑fixing required without
disturbing adjacent finishes.

26 D8. Floor Providing, fabricating/supplying, transporting, installing, testing and commissioning D8. Floor 26.26 sqm 32,219.00
Indicator Indicator (Staircase), complete in all respects as per designs and GFC drawings issued by the
(Staircase) Design Consultant, fire‑safety and accessibility guidelines, Detailed Specifications, Common
Specifications and directions of the Engineer‑in‑Charge. The Consultant shall supply all artwork;
the contractor shall produce shop drawings only where required by the Authority. Signs shall
comprise custom aluminium profile approximately 10 mm deep with anodised finish in approved
colour or equivalent corrosion‑resistant coating, housing self‑maintaining photoluminescent
safety‑way‑guidance signage made from minimum 1 mm thick rigid ARS 10000 or equivalent
sheet with strong self‑adhesive backing. The photoluminescent sheet shall be self‑extinguishing,
non‑peelable, non‑scratchable, non‑breakable, with silk‑screen printed UV‑resistant paint
complying with PSPA Class A / DIN 67510, luminance greater than 700 mcd/m² at specified time
and glow duration exceeding 24 hours, certified by a Government of India laboratory, DRDO and
ARAI or equivalent and approved by local Fire Services. Signs shall be fixed on staircase
elements using self‑tapping screws and/or 3M VHB tape or equivalent, with all substrate
preparation, minor breaking or cutting of surfaces as necessary, complete making good,
cleaning and any careful dismantling/re‑installation required, together with any associated
electrical works shown on drawings.
